Output 45e15cbe3c6dea155051f432aa05b9370e4a164cfa270f141b46ed1cff898d59:7

value
4467694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2408606bb301bebf3a32681648138a41c3271839 OP_EQUAL
address
34yYHUA5dq53ATTpiF55ufQEo6d2kjMA7s
transaction
45e15cbe3c6dea155051f432aa05b9370e4a164cfa270f141b46ed1cff898d59
spent
true